Let C, P and G denotes the number of children, parents and the grandparents in the function.
We get the system of equations,
C + P + G = 400 [equation 1]
P = 2G ⇒ G = P/2 [equation 2]
C = P + 50 [equation 3]
Substituting 2 and 3 in 1,
(P + 50) + P + (P/2) = 400
2P + P/2 = 350
5/2 P = 350
P = 140
C = P + 50 = 140 + 50 = 190
G = P/2 = 140/2 = 70
Hence the number of parents = 140, grandparents = 70 and children = 190.

The Keller family needs to rent a 10 cubic meter dumpster to collect waste from a construction project. Discount Dumpster rents a dumpster of that size for $225 plus a charge of $ 130 per ton of waste. Mega Dumpster rents the same size dumpster for $300, but only charges $90 per ton of waste. For what values of tons of waste, w, would Mega Dumpster be less expensive than Discount Dumpster?
For waste of more than 1.875 tons mega Dumpster be less expensive than Discount Dumpster.
Given that,
Discount Dumpster rents a dumpster of that size for $225 plus a charge of $ 130 per ton of waste.
Mega Dumpster rents the same size dumpster for $300, but only charges $90 per ton of waste.
Inequality can be defined as the relation of the equation containing the symbol of ( ≤, ≥, <, >) instead of the equal sign in an equation.
Here,
accoding to the question,
225 + 130w > 300 + w90
130w - 90w > 300 - 225
40w > 75
w > 15 / 8
W > 1.875
Thus, for waste of more than 1.875 tons mega Dumpster be less expensive than Discount Dumpster.

Evaluate the double integral ∬R(3x−y)dA, where R is the region in the first quadrant enclosed by the circle x2+y2=16 and the lines x=0 and y=x, by changing to polar coordinates.
Answer:
\(\displaystyle 64-32\sqrt{2}+\frac{32\sqrt{2}}{3}\approx3.66\)
Step-by-step explanation:
\(\displaystyle \iint_R(3x-y)\,dA\\\\=\int^\frac{\pi}{2}_\frac{\pi}{4}\int^4_0(3r\cos\theta-r\sin\theta)\,r\,dr\,d\theta\\\\=\int^\frac{\pi}{2}_\frac{\pi}{4}\int^4_0(3r^2\cos\theta-r^2\sin\theta)\,dr\,d\theta\\\\=\int^\frac{\pi}{2}_\frac{\pi}{4}\int^4_0r^2(3\cos\theta-\sin\theta)\,dr\,d\theta\\\\=\int^\frac{\pi}{2}_\frac{\pi}{4}\frac{64}{3}(3\cos\theta-\sin\theta)\,d\theta\\\\=\int^\frac{\pi}{2}_\frac{\pi}{4}\biggr(64\cos\theta-\frac{64}{3}\sin\theta\biggr)\,d\theta\)
\(\displaystyle =\biggr(64\sin\theta+\frac{64}{3}\cos\theta\biggr)\biggr|^\frac{\pi}{2}_\frac{\pi}{4}\\\\=\biggr(64\sin\frac{\pi}{2}+\frac{64}{3}\cos\frac{\pi}{2}\biggr)-\biggr(64\sin\frac{\pi}{4}+\frac{64}{3}\cos\frac{\pi}{4}\biggr)\\\\=64-\biggr(64\cdot{\frac{\sqrt{2}}{2}}+\frac{64}{3}\cdot{\frac{\sqrt{2}}{2}}\biggr)\\\\=64-32\sqrt{2}+\frac{32\sqrt{2}}{3}\biggr\\\\\approx3.66\)
Current assets are assets that are expected to be converted to cash, sold or consumed in the next
12 months. They include cash, accounts receivable, notes receivable, inventory and prepaid
expenses. Step 8 explains each one in detail.
1. You are the owner of an appliance store. Choose four categories from above and explain how
that asset may fit into your business. For example, if I owned a company that installed furnaces,
my inventory would include different types of furnaces and air conditioners as well as controls
to operate them. Accounts receivable would include the installations we did but have not been
paid for yet.
How these current asset may fit into your business, like mine, is explained as follows:
Cash: Cash is a crucial asset for any business, as it is needed to pay for expenses such as salaries, rent, and other operating costs.Accounts Receivable: It represents the amount of money owed to the business by its customers and is a key part of the business's revenue stream. Inventory: Inventory represents the value of the goods that are available for sale and can include raw materials, work-in-progress, and finished products.Prepaid Expenses: Prepaid expenses can be a helpful asset for businesses that make regular payments for services or goods, such as insurance or rent. Explanation on items of the Current assets:Cash: Cash refers to physical currency or money that is readily available to a business or individual. It includes cash on hand, in bank accounts, or other forms of liquid assets that can be easily converted to cash.Accounts Receivable: Accounts receivable refers to the amount of money owed to a business by its customers or clients for goods or services that have been sold but not yet paid for. It represents the short-term credit that a business has extended to its customers.Notes Receivable: Notes receivable are similar to accounts receivable but involve more formal written agreements. They are written promises by a borrower to pay a specific sum of money at a future date to a creditor, with interest.Inventory: Inventory refers to the goods that a business holds for sale to customers or for use in its operations. It includes raw materials, work-in-progress, and finished goods that have not yet been sold.Prepaid Expenses: Prepaid expenses refer to payments made by a business for goods or services that have not yet been used or consumed. They are considered assets because they represent future economic benefits that will be realized by the business. Examples include prepaid rent, insurance premiums, and other prepayments.Read more about Current assets

(Numerical problems) A car is running with the velocity of 72km/h. What will be it's velocity after 5s if it's acceleration is -2m/s square
Step-by-step explanation:
72km/h = 72,000m/3,600s = 20m/s.
Using Kinematics, we have
v = u + at
= (20m/s) + (-2m/s²)(5s)
= 10m/s.
Hence the velocity will be 10m/s. (or 36km/h)

A student researcher compares the ages of cars owned by students and cars owned by faculty at a local state college. A sample of 263 cars owned by students had an average age of 7.25 years. A sample of 291 cars owned by faculty had an average age of 7.12 years. Assume that the population standard deviation for cars owned by students is 3.77 years, while the population standard deviation for cars owned by faculty is 2.99 years. Determine the 90% confidence interval for the difference between the true mean ages for cars owned by students and faculty. Step 1 of 3: Find the point estimate for the true difference between the population means.
Answer:
The point estimate for the true difference between the population means is 0.13.
The 90% confidence interval for the difference between the true mean ages for cars owned by students and faculty is between -0.35 years and 0.61 years.
Step-by-step explanation:
To solve this question, before building the confidence interval, we need to understand the central limit theorem and subtraction between normal variables.
Central Limit Theorem
The Central Limit Theorem estabilishes that, for a normally distributed random variable X, with mean \(\mu\) and standard deviation \(\sigma\), the sampling distribution of the sample means with size n can be approximated to a normal distribution with mean \(\mu\) and standard deviation \(s = \frac{\sigma}{\sqrt{n}}\).
For a skewed variable, the Central Limit Theorem can also be applied, as long as n is at least 30.
Subtraction between normal variables:
When we subtract two normal variables, the mean is the subtraction of the means while the standard deviation is the square root of the sum of the variances.
A sample of 263 cars owned by students had an average age of 7.25 years. The population standard deviation for cars owned by students is 3.77 years.
This means that:
\(\mu_s = 7.25, \sigma_s = 3.77, n = 263, s_s = \frac{3.77}{\sqrt{263}} = 0.2325\)
A sample of 291 cars owned by faculty had an average age of 7.12 years. The population standard deviation for cars owned by faculty is 2.99 years.
This means that:
\(\mu_f = 7.12, \sigma_f = 2.99, n = 291, s_f = \frac{2.99}{\sqrt{291}} = 0.1753\)
Difference between the true mean ages for cars owned by students and faculty.
Distribution s - f. So
\(\mu = \mu_s - \mu_f = 7.25 - 7.12 = 0.13\)
This is also the point estimate for the true difference between the population means.
\(s = \sqrt{s_s^2+s_f^2} = \sqrt{0.2325^2+0.1753^2} = 0.2912\)
90% confidence interval for the difference:
We have that to find our \(\alpha\) level, that is the subtraction of 1 by the confidence interval divided by 2. So:
\(\alpha = \frac{1 - 0.9}{2} = 0.05\)
Now, we have to find z in the Ztable as such z has a pvalue of \(1 - \alpha\).
That is z with a pvalue of \(1 - 0.05 = 0.95\), so Z = 1.645.
Now, find the margin of error M as such
\(M = zs = 1.645*0.2912 = 0.48\)
The lower end of the interval is the sample mean subtracted by M. So it is 0.13 - 0.48 = -0.35 years
The upper end of the interval is the sample mean added to M. So it is 0.13 + 0.48 = 0.61 years.
The 90% confidence interval for the difference between the true mean ages for cars owned by students and faculty is between -0.35 years and 0.61 years.
